1. How to install the software on this CD-ROM if you are running
   Windows 95/98/Me/NT4.0/2000/XP

   1.1 Installation steps on Windows 95/98/NT 4.0/2000/Me/XP systems

       If you have Windows 95/98/NT 4.0/2000/Me/XP on your system,
       the software installation process is simple as this CD-ROM is 
       Autoplay enabled. Follow the steps outlined below:

       (a) Insert this CD-ROM into your CD-ROM drive.
	
       (b) The 'Welcome' screen which contains a menu of available
           options will appear. This is the Setup Options menu.
   
       (c) Check the applications you want to install and click the OK
           button. Follow the instructions on the screen to complete
           the installation.


    1.2 Additional Windows 95/98/NT 4.0/2000/Me/XP Notes

        1.2.1  If you wish to re-install any of the software on the
               CD-ROM later, you can eject this CD-ROM from your
               CD-ROM drive, and then close the CD-ROM tray. Windows
               95/98/NT 4.0/2000/Me/XP will recognize the CD-ROM's 
	       Autoplay feature and the Setup Options menu will be 
	       made available again.

2. Software Addendum

   2.1  Oozic Player and DirectX

        Oozic Player requires components from Microsoft DirectX 7.0a and 
        above to be installed.

        To install the latest DirectX components on your PC, run the
        DirectX setup program called DXSETUP.EXE ( Found in the \DIRECTX 
	folder of this CD ).

   2.2 Modem On Hold(MOH) 

        MOH requires Netwaiting application to be installed. Netwaiting SDK 
        must be installed before installing Netwaiting application. 
        MOH is supported in Windows 98SE, Windows Me & Windows 2000 only.

How To Update Drivers Manually

After your driver has been downloaded, follow these simple steps to install it.

  • Expand the archive file (if the download file is in zip or rar format).

  • If the expanded file has an .exe extension, double click it and follow the installation instructions.

  • Otherwise, open Device Manager by right-clicking the Start menu and selecting Device Manager.

  • Find the device and model you want to update in the device list.

  • Double-click on it to open the Properties dialog box.

  • From the Properties dialog box, select the Driver tab.

  • Click the Update Driver button, then follow the instructions.

Very important: You must reboot your system to ensure that any driver updates have taken effect.
